What is MEAN stack?

The open-source, JavaScript-based MEAN stack, sometimes referred to as MEAN.js, is a group of tools that has revolutionized how programmers create web and mobile applications.

MEAN is an acronym that stands for-

  • MongoDB
  • Express
  • Angular
  • Node.JS

A collection of different technologies called Mean.js can be used to create dynamic websites and online applications. MongoDB is utilized as the database system, Express.js is used as the back-end web framework, node.js is used as the web server, and Angular.js is used as the front-end framework in a web application developed with Mean.js.

A MEAN stack programmer would be an expert in one or more of these fields. The phrase “MEAN stack development” offers a methodical process that incorporates these elements. ExpressJS, AngularJS, NodeJS, and MongoDB JS-based software developers are comparable to MEAN stack programmers.

Exploring Each MEAN Stack Component

 

1.  MongoDB

The database used in web development is called MongoDB. It is a NoSQL database, which is a type of document-oriented, non-relational database management system. It saves the data in the form of documents because it is a database management system that is focused on papers. In contrast to MongoDB, a NoSQL database, which employs the BSON language to query the database, SQL databases use the SQL query language to do so. JSON is a text-based format; however, it is slow and takes up a lot of room. BSON was created to improve the speed and space efficiency of MongoDB. BSON essentially stores the JSON format in a binary form that reduces complexity, speed, and storage requirements.

2.  Express.js

Express.js is a back-end web application framework that is available for free and open source. It is frequently utilized in well-liked development stacks, such as MEAN and a MongoDB database. TJ Holowaychuk created Express.js. Let’s explore some benefits of express.js-

  • The software is straightforward and portable. Installing it on the computer and starting the application does not require much effort.
  • As we can see, it offers the versatility we need and is simple to design and configure.
  • Express.js is is a superior alternative for establishing the API when the application needs a variety of APIs to communicate with different users.

 

3.  Angular.js

A JavaScript framework called Angular.js is used to create web applications. Google is the company that developed this framework. Now that there are numerous JavaScript frameworks on the market, a question emerges- Why do we favor Angular.js over the competition when creating web applications? Let’s explore why.

  • Since it is a two-way data binding, the model and view are always up to date. The view will automatically update following any model modifications.
  • Testing is a key consideration in the design of Angular.js. The angular.js application’s components can be tested using both unit testing and end-to-end testing.
  • It is simple to create the application using an MVC architecture with Angular.js.

Benefits of MEAN Stack

An open-source web stack called MEAN is mostly employed to build cloud-hosted apps. Applications built using the MEAN stack are scalable, adaptable, and flexible, which makes them ideal for hosting in the cloud. The stack comes with its web server, making deployment simple, and the database may be expanded on demand to handle brief surges in consumption. A MEAN application enters the world ready to benefit from all the cloud’s cost reductions and performance enhancements.

For many years, JavaScript has been a preferred language for front-end web development because it is adaptable, dynamic, and simple to use. However, for a few years, it has only been a choice for backend and database development, allowing programmers to build complete apps using JavaScript. Your development teams can operate more efficiently since MEAN employs the same language throughout. MEAN does away with the requirement that each component of an application is developed by a different professional. Instead, you can make use of a single pool of JavaScript developers to respond quickly to changing circumstances. The potential to reuse code throughout the entire program is another benefit of standardizing JavaScript, preventing needless innovation.

MEAN Stack Use Cases

The MEAN stack excels in many applications, even though it isn’t ideal for all of them. It is a good option for creating cloud-native applications because of its scalability and capacity for handling multiple concurrent users. It is also perfect for creating single-page applications (SPAs) that provide all information and functionality on a single page thanks to the AngularJS frontend framework. Here are a few MEAN usage examples- Calendars, News aggregation, expense tracking, etc.
